ADVANTAGES OF NETWORKING YOUR HOME COMPUTER



Computers have become an integral part of our life, not just at work but at home as well. It is not unusual for a household to have two or more computers. Just like an office, you can network your home computers together in order to share documents, photos, video, and more. Many homeowners have discovered that a home network is an affordable solution to sharing your family's high-speed Internet connection and computing resources.

A network is a system that connects two or more computers together so that they can share information and the use of peripherals. Before this technology was readily available, consumers had to buy each computer its own printer, scanner, and Internet access. This made adding another computer a very expensive proposition.

There are two types of home networking systems, wired and wireless. As you might guess, wired systems require that you physically connect each computer or device using specialized cables. A wireless system requires no cables because it uses a radio wave to transmit data between the machines.

A home network offers a variety of advantages to the homeowner. Listed below are a few reasons that networking is so popular in many homes.

Broadband Internet Sharing: Networking enables two or more people to browse the Internet at the same time. This feature allows many members of the family to research, work, and shop at the same time without having to wait their turn. For one fee, you can provide Internet access for all of the computers in the home.

File Sharing: Networking allows you to share and access files that are stored on various computers in your network. This means that you can finish up the report on your laptop that you started on your desktop computer in the home office. You can also access photos, videos, and documents on any computer in your network. Many people appreciate the flexibility that this feature offers.

Peripheral Sharing: Once your network is up and running, you can set up all of your computers to have access to peripherals like the printer and scanner. There are substantial savings with only having to buy one device to be used on multiple computers.

Understanding Static IP And Dynamic Ip

Understanding Static IP and Dynamic IP
The use of computers and the Internet will never be separated from the use of IP. Because it's here I'll explain a bit about IP, IP broadly differentiated into static and dynamic IP

If the computer uses the same IP address each time they connect to the network (eg Internet), then said to have a static IP address (fixed). If the IP address changes frequently, when the computer is connected to a network (internet), it is said to have a dynamic IP address.

Dynamic IP addresses are typically used for a simple network, broadband network and a USB modem, while the static IP address that is used to find the server in the enterprise.

Currently, two versions of the Internet Protocol (IP) is being used :
- IPv4 address to use 32-bit address space is limited

- IPv6 is designed as a replacement for IPv4, as 128-bit wide addresses, whereas IPv6 offer a huge address space.

How To Manage A Remote Desktop

Use of the Remote Desktop feature allows you to connect your computer (host) from another remote computer (the client). This feature allows you to access all computer resources (installed programs, data etc.). Using this feature you can also run computer applications on a remote computer as you do on your PC. This allows you to control your computer from anywhere in the world!

To activate and use this option, follow these steps :

First, notice to perform these tasks need to be at least two computers connected to the Internet. You must configure the host computer that allows users to connect remotely. On the host computer, right click on My Computer and click Properties. Remote tab, select the option "Allow users to connect remotely to this computer" and click Apply, then OK. Now you should get an IP address from the host computer (type ipconfig / all command prompt on the host computer to find the IP address or visit a site that allows you to detect your IP) Notes and follow the steps.

Second, Now we will establish a remote connection on the client machine for this, click Start, go to All Programs> Accessories. Now select the Remote Desktop Connection. "Remote Desktop Connection dialog box will appear". Click Options, General tab, type the IP address of the host computer (you marked in the previous step) in the computer box. Then type in your user name and password from the host computer (if necessary) and click Log In to connect to remote computers. That's it. That you have shown all of the requested information (IP address, user name and password), the remote desktop window should manifest itself and you can manage the computer away from you.

Problems and solutions :
-You must pay attention to certain control of the remote computer you must have their IP address. The problem is that IP addresses are usually dynamic, and to use this feature you must have a static IP address.

-Remote Desktop only works on some versions of Windows (XP Pro and Vista Pro and others ...)

-Some software firewall blocking remote access, in this case made an exception in your firewall configuration.

Difference Method Wifi Security WEP and WPA

Various kinds of research on WEP has been done and the conclusion that even though a wireless network protected by WEP, hackers can still break in.. A hacker who has a makeshift wireless equipment and software tools used to collect and analyze enough data, can know the encryption key used. WEP (Wired Equivalent Privacy) is no longer able to be relied on to provide a wireless connection (wireless) safe from nosy people act or want to take advantage of what we have-known by the jargon hackers. Not long after the development process of WEP, the fragility of the cryptography aspects emerge.

See the weakness which is owned by WEP, has developed a new security technique called WPA (WiFi Protected Access). WPA technique is a model compatible with the IEEE 802.11i draft standard specification. This technique has several objectives in the design are: solid, interoperates, can be used to replace WEP, can be implemented at home or corporate users, and available to the public as quickly as possible. Technique was established to provide development WPA data encryption WEP is a weak point, and provides user authentication that seems lost on the development concept of WEP.

Networking between XP and Vista

Many time windows vista and windows xp in a same network but both machine are not able to see each other. Main reason is windows vista automatically takes name of network as “workgroup” and in windows xp default name is “mshome”. If you make sure that both computer have same network name.
You can change the network name in windows xp by right click on my computer
Choose property
Then select computer name option
Then at the bottom workgroup name give the name what ever you like and
Apply and then ok
You need to restart your windows xp system to apply changes.

To change network name in windows vista
Right click on my computer and then property
Systems many, select change setting
It will pop up computer name, change the workgroup name.
And apply and ok

HOW TO UPGRADE RAM IN AN APPLE COMPUTER

If your Mac is using the latest applications, chances are that your machine may become slow over time. If the delays on opening new apps, trying to work online or simply play a video on your Mac is becoming a pain, you may have thought about the price of a new machine and cringed.
You don't need to do it.
Instead of shelling out a couple grand on a beautiful new Mac, and you're handy with a screwdriver, you can simply upgrade the RAM in your machine or pay a professional if you're not confident.
First the bad news. If you have a MacBook Air, you will not be able to upgrade RAM. It's soldered onto the logic board and I would advise against it. (Breaking your MacBook Air defeats the purpose of trying to speed it up.)
Unibody MacBook: Remove the bottom cover to gain access to the RAM.
MacBook: If you have an older model MacBook, the RAM in these machines are located adjacent to the battery. Remove the battery and the memory door and pull on those little levers to gain access to the RAM.
Unibody MacBook Pro: Take off the bottom cover, disconnect the battery and unlock the RAM tabs.
MacBook Pro: Just take out the battery, the screws and memory door. Behold the RAM!
